656871031455141 is an odd composite number. It is composed of four distinct prime numbers multiplied together. It has a total of twenty-four divisors.

Prime factorization of 656871031455141:

3 × 23 × 592 × 2734808969

(3 × 23 × 59 × 59 × 2734808969)
